
A 24-year-old Mississauga man is facing several weapons-related charges in connection with an incident involving a fake gun in the River Grove area.
A suspect, police allege, pointed and threatened the driver of another vehicle using a replica firearm at 10:30 p.m. Friday near Bristol Rd. W. and Creditview Rd.
“The replica firearm is made to look like a real firearm,” said Peel Regional Police Const. Rachel Gibbs.
The victim phoned 911 and no injuries were reported from the pellet gun.
The suspect turned himself in at 11 Division at 5:20 a.m. Saturday.
David Ha is scheduled to appear in Brampton court on Feb. 26.
